Spinsys-Dine is seeking a Business Intelligence/ETL Developer to support a leading effort in the design, implementation and maintenance of self service business intelligence portals, client/internal dashboards, and associated reports and data feeds. This person will be responsible for implementing and maintaining reporting and business intelligence solutions to support the customer. The qualified candidate will have experience working directly with customer to gather requirements and conduct demonstrations and training where required, so communication and professionalism are a must. In addition, this person will work with other remote team members in an agile development environment that is high energy and rewarding.
Job Duties and Responsibilities:
BI Development:
- Design, develop, and implement comprehensive BI solutions using tools such as Tableau, Power BI, or similar platforms.
- Create and maintain dashboards, reports, and visualizations that provide actionable insights to business stakeholders.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into technical specifications for BI solutions.
- Identify trends, patterns, and anomalies in data to support business strategies and improve decision-making.
- Perform data validation and ensure data accuracy and integrity in all reporting outputs.
ETL Development:
- Design and implement efficient ETL processes to collect, transform, integrate, and load data from various sources into the data warehouse.
- Develop and maintain ETL scripts and workflows using tools such as SSIS, Informatica, Talend, or similar platforms.
- Optimize and tune ETL performance to handle large volumes of data and ensure timely processing.
- Monitor and troubleshoot ETL processes to ensure data completeness and quality.
- Work with database administrators to ensure that the underlying data architecture is suitable for responsive BI solutions.
Data Management:
- Collaborate with data architects and data engineers to ensure alignment of BI and ETL solutions with the overall data strategy.
- Maintain metadata, documentation, and data dictionaries for BI and ETL processes.
- Implement best practices for data governance and ensure compliance with data security policies.
Collaboration & Communication:
- Work closely with business analysts, stakeholders, and IT teams to understand business objectives and provide data solutions that meet organizational needs.
- Communicate complex data findings in a clear and concise manner to non-technical stakeholders.
- Support end-users in understanding and using BI solutions effectively.
- Continuous Improvement:
- Stay updated with industry trends and advancements in BI and ETL technologies.
- Identify opportunities for process improvement and contribute to initiatives that enhance data capabilities.
- Other duties as assigned.
